Why Choose Steel Gears in Drills?

Before diving into which DeWalt drills have steel gears, it’s essential to understand why this feature matters. Gears are a crucial part of any drill’s mechanism since they transfer power from the motor to the chuck, affecting the tool’s torque and speed.

Benefits of Steel Gears

Steel gears come with numerous advantages that enhance the performance and durability of a drill:

  • Increased Durability: Steel is more robust than plastic and can withstand higher stresses, leading to a longer lifespan.
  • Better Torque Transfer: Steel gears ensure efficient torque transfer, helping the drill perform optimally under heavy loads.

These benefits make steel gear drills an excellent investment for anyone looking to tackle heavy-duty tasks.

Understanding the Construction of Steel Gears

When discussing steel gears, it’s crucial to understand their construction.

Material Quality

Steel gears are typically made from high-quality materials like carbon steel, giving them strength and resilience. Unlike plastic gears, these ensure that the drill maintains its efficacy, especially during prolonged use.

Manufacturing Process

The manufacturing process involves precision and heat treatment, optimizing the gears for strength and wear resistance. This attention to detail is what makes DeWalt a leader in the industry.

How can I maintain my DeWalt drill with steel gears?

Maintaining a DeWalt drill with steel gears involves regular cleaning and lubrication to ensure optimal performance. After each use, it is essential to remove debris and sawdust from the drill to prevent build-up that could potentially affect its functionality. A soft brush or cloth can effectively clean accessible areas. Keep the air vents clean as well, as this helps prevent overheating.

Additionally, lubricating moving parts periodically can help reduce friction, allowing the steel gears to function smoothly. It’s also a good idea to check for any signs of wear or damage regularly. If you notice any unusual noises or decreased performance, it may be a sign that further maintenance or repair is needed. Following these steps can extend the life of your drill and ensure it performs at its best.

What is the warranty on DeWalt drills with steel gears?

DeWalt typically offers a three-year limited warranty on their power tools, including drills with steel gears. This warranty covers defects in materials and workmanship, ensuring that the drill will be repaired or replaced if any issues arise under normal use conditions. However, the specifics of the warranty may vary by model, so it is essential to read the warranty details that come with your drill.

In addition to the limited warranty, DeWalt provides a one-year free service contract, which includes free maintenance and repair, extending support beyond the initial warranty period. This service contract can be extremely beneficial for users relying on their tools for demanding tasks, as it ensures ongoing assistance and maintenance without additional costs.
